By Bob Baker
The professional InstallShield for home windows® Installer Developer's consultant explores the home windows Installer provider (WIS) and the industry-leading InstallShield software for placing this new home windows 2000 function to paintings. Written by way of Bob Baker, an InstallShield insider, this name is a complete, one-volume advisor to WIS and the Microsoft rules governing its use. furthermore, the publication indicates you the way to construct consumer installations utilizing an easy modifying instrument or the full-blown InstallShield for home windows Installer advertisement package deal. An accompanying CD features a absolutely useful review replica of InstallShield for home windows Installer model 1.52.
Read or Download The Official InstallShield for Windows Installer Developer's Guide PDF
Best windows desktop books
Scripting presents approach directors an optimum technique of automating tedious and time-consuming program, configuration, and administration initiatives. furthermore you could reap the benefits of new services provided via VBScript, ADSI and home windows Scripting Host. ADSI is especially vital in mild of the approaching unlock of home windows 2000, because it offers a way of having access to performance within the lively listing Microsoft's highly-publicized listing carrier.
And evaluation ebook: to adopt an excursion into those new and to a wide volume unexplored territories, explaining alongside the way in which what a majority of these issues suggest to current courses and their local use below Win32 structures. in any case, earlier than placing such great issues as a number of threads or Unicode into their functions, builders need to port them to Win32 within the first position!
(Black & White version) additionally to be had in full-color paperback, or on Kindle. Over four hundred instance pictures starting home windows eight and Microsoft place of work 2013 is designed to assist those who find themselves new to home windows eight and Microsoft workplace 2013, in addition to those who would possibly not have used past types of home windows and workplace.
Advance easy internet purposes with the strong Django framework review Get to grasp MVC development and the constitution of Django Create your first website with Django mechanisms permit consumer interplay with kinds application tremendous speedy types with Django good points. discover the easiest practices to strengthen purposes of a great caliber intimately Django is a strong Python internet framework designed for fast net program improvement.
- MCSA/MCSE Windows XP Professional Study Guide
- Essential Windows presentation foundation
- Windows XP Headaches: How to Fix Common (and Not So Common) Problems in a Hurry
- Teach Yourself TCP/IP in 14 Days
- MCSA/MCSE 70-270 Exam Prep 2: Windows XP Professional
Additional resources for The Official InstallShield for Windows Installer Developer's Guide
The last item to be discussed as far as kernel mode implementation is concerned is the block in our figure called System Threads. These are special threads that run only in kernel mode and are housed in the system process. Many of the modules described above use system threads to perform their functions. qc 1/16/01 11:06 AM Page 21 Chapter 2: The Windows 2000 Deployment Architecture not have a user-process address space and therefore must allocate any dynamic memory from the operating-system memory heap.
EXE. On the Windows 2000 CD-ROM there are two versions of this file, which provides the executive and kernel functionality. EXE if the machine has more than one processor. When we talk about process management in Windows 2000, we need to talk about both processes and threads. We don’t need to talk about programs since a program is just a static set of bits on a disk somewhere. A process is a dynamic entity that can be considered a set of resources that is reserved for the threads that are executing inside the process.
When a thread requests access to memory, it uses a virtual memory address and this gets translated into a physical memory address before data or code is moved. ◆ Moving code or data to disk when it has to be moved out of physical memory because another thread or process needs that physical location. This activity is normally called paging. Even though there are 4 GB of virtual memory, because of the 32-bit addressing scheme of Windows 2000 only 2 GB of this are available to user-mode processes.